Wyndham Storm Lake - Hours & Locations

1

Wyndham - Storm Lake

101 W. Milwaukee Ave., Storm Lake IA 50588-1863 Phone Number:(712) 732-3063
  1. Store Hours

Hours may fluctuate

Distance:0.62 miles
Edit
2

Wyndham - Storm Lake

1726 Lake Ave., Storm Lake IA 50588 Phone Number:(712) 732-1000
  1. Store Hours

Hours may fluctuate

Distance:1.46 miles
Edit
3

Wyndham - Cherokee

1400 N 2nd St, Cherokee IA 51012-2202 Phone Number:(712) 225-4278
  1. Store Hours

Hours may fluctuate

Distance:19.45 miles
Edit
4

Wyndham - Ida Grove

90 East Highway 175, Ida Grove IA 51445 Phone Number:(712) 364-3988
  1. Store Hours

Hours may fluctuate

Distance:24.11 miles
Edit